About Windsor, CA

Windsor is a city in California, located in Sonoma County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 27,455 residents. It is a middle-aged city, with a median age of 42.4 years.

Economically, Windsor is a upper-middle-income community. The median household income of $131,022 is significantly above the national average. Approximately 4.9%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 4.0%, below the national average.

The real estate market in Windsor is a premium housing market. Median home values stand at $777,700, which is more than double the national average. Renters typically pay around $2,149 per month. Homeownership is high at 75.0%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Windsor is well-educated. 46.8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— above the national average. The community is majority White (59.32%).
